Singapore, Oct. 25 (BNA): Oil fell for a fourth day on Wednesday as concerns about slowing European demand offset.
Brent crude futures dropped 28 cents, or 0.3%, to $87.79 a barrel as of 0627 GMT.
While U.S. West Texas Intermediate crude futures were down 31 cents, or 0.4%, to $83.43 a barrel, Reuters reported.
U.S. inventories declined by about 2.7 million barrels in the week ended on Oct. 20, according to market sources citing American Petroleum Institute figures on Tuesday.
